Transaction d99e86760f28bdcd853060ef7ea452aba3608e6d89263fbcf3f8e59a50e3ed82
1 Input
1 Output
-
d99e86760f28bdcd853060ef7ea452aba3608e6d89263fbcf3f8e59a50e3ed82:0
- value
- 6780658
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 45274463653918f26e39ca041047cb133635eee8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17JefZn71PZgg2W31U61HFCUgtw7uUq43U